Electric Power Steering (EPS) Sensor Market


The global Electric Power Steering (EPS) sensor market is undergoing rapid expansion as the automotive industry shifts away from traditional hydraulic steering toward fully electronic steering architectures. EPS systems rely on precise sensor data—primarily torque sensors and steering angle sensors—to measure driver steering input and vehicle dynamics. The electronic control unit (ECU) processes this real-time data to determine the exact level of assistance required from an electric assist motor. By replacing engine-driven hydraulic pumps with power-on-demand electric motors, EPS systems significantly enhance overall fuel efficiency, lower carbon emissions, and optimize engine power output.
